• Deception Technology Market Growth: Key Trends, Industries, and Regional Insights

    Deception Technology market is poised for substantial growth in the coming years, driven by the escalating complexity and frequency of cyber-attacks. As traditional cybersecurity solutions struggle to keep pace with advanced threats, organizations are increasingly turning to Deception Technology to gain a strategic advantage. This innovative approach involves deploying decoys, traps, and fake assets within networks to detect, analyze, and neutralize malicious activities before they can cause significant damage.

  • Security Orchestration and Automation Market: Growth, Trends, and Innovations

    In today’s digital world, organizations face an unprecedented volume and complexity of cyber threats. From phishing and ransomware to advanced persistent threats, the modern threat landscape is both sophisticated and diverse. Traditional security operations centers (SOCs) are often overwhelmed by the sheer number of alerts and incidents they must handle daily, leading to delayed responses and increased risk exposure. This is where Security Orchestration, Automation, and Response (SOAR) solutions become essential.

    SOAR platforms are designed to streamline and automate incident response processes, enabling security teams to manage threats more efficiently. By integrating threat intelligence, automated workflows, and incident management tools, SOAR solutions significantly reduce the time and effort required to investigate and respond to security events. Automation helps eliminate repetitive tasks such as alert triage, data enrichment, and initial response actions, allowing security analysts to focus on complex, high-priority threats.

    Beyond efficiency, SOAR enhances the accuracy and speed of threat detection and response. Automated workflows ensure consistent handling of incidents according to predefined playbooks, minimizing human error and improving response times. This proactive approach not only mitigates potential damage from attacks but also strengthens the organization’s overall cybersecurity posture.

    Another key advantage of SOAR solutions is improved collaboration among security teams. These platforms provide centralized dashboards that offer comprehensive visibility into ongoing incidents, enabling analysts, IT staff, and management to coordinate their efforts effectively. With real-time insights and unified reporting, teams can make informed decisions and respond to threats in a cohesive manner.

    Moreover, SOAR platforms support compliance with regulatory requirements. Many industries face strict mandates regarding incident reporting, data protection, and security controls. SOAR solutions help organizations document and track incident handling processes, providing audit-ready records that demonstrate adherence to compliance standards.

    Understanding the Market Landscape

    SSPM solutions are designed to provide continuous visibility and control across SaaS environments, focusing on user permissions, application configurations, and data-sharing pathways. Misconfigurations, overly permissive access, and unauthorized data exposure are among the most significant risks organizations face today. The latest SSPM platforms address these challenges through deep API integrations, machine learning–driven risk analytics, and automated remediation capabilities.

    Key Capabilities of Modern SSPM Platforms
    The most mature SSPM solutions combine continuous monitoring, context-aware visibility, and automated remediation to maintain a secure SaaS environment. Key functionalities include:

    Real-time risk detection: Identifying abnormal activities, sensitive data exposure, and excessive access permissions.

    Automated policy enforcement: Correcting configuration drifts and enforcing least privilege principles.

    Regulatory alignment: Ensuring SaaS environments comply with relevant frameworks and standards.

    Integration with broader security ecosystems: Seamless collaboration with CASB, IAM, and SIEM systems enhances long-term effectiveness.

    Cross-team collaboration: Security, compliance, and application teams work together to maintain resilience against emerging threats.

    According to experts, the effectiveness of SSPM platforms depends on continuous rule optimization, proactive monitoring, and strategic integration with other cloud security solutions. Organizations that adopt these best practices can significantly reduce the risks associated with misconfigurations, data leaks, and unauthorized access.

  • Digital Risk Protection Market: Trends, Growth, and Forecast

    In today’s hyper-connected world, organizations face an unprecedented volume and complexity of cyber threats. From sophisticated phishing attacks to ransomware and supply chain vulnerabilities, the digital landscape presents numerous risks that can compromise sensitive data, intellectual property, and overall business continuity. This is where Digital Risk Protection (DRP) becomes an essential component of a modern cybersecurity strategy.

    DRP solutions provide organizations with proactive measures to identify, monitor, and mitigate digital threats before they escalate into costly breaches. By continuously scanning the internet, dark web, and other digital channels, DRP tools detect potential exposures of sensitive data, brand impersonation attempts, and fraudulent activities. Early detection allows businesses to respond swiftly, preventing financial losses and reputational damage that can result from cyber incidents.

    Beyond protecting data and assets, DRP plays a critical role in maintaining operational continuity. In an era where downtime can lead to significant revenue loss, organizations need the ability to quickly detect and respond to threats. DRP systems enable real-time monitoring and automated alerts, ensuring that potential risks are addressed before they disrupt essential operations. This proactive approach not only safeguards business processes but also strengthens stakeholder confidence and customer trust.

    Another key advantage of DRP is its ability to address third-party and supply chain risks. Many organizations rely on vendors and partners for critical services, which can introduce additional vulnerabilities. DRP provides visibility into these external risks, allowing companies to assess and mitigate threats associated with their extended digital ecosystem. This is particularly important as supply chain attacks become increasingly common and sophisticated.

    Additionally, DRP supports regulatory compliance and brand protection. Organizations are often required to adhere to data protection regulations, such as GDPR or CCPA, and failure to do so can result in substantial penalties. By continuously monitoring for potential breaches and unauthorized use of intellectual property, DRP solutions help businesses maintain compliance and protect their brand reputation in a competitive marketplace.
